Peer reviewedBradbard, David A.; Green, Samuel B. – Journal of Experimental Education, 1986
The effectiveness of the Coombs elimination procedure was evaluated with 29 college students enrolled in a statistics course. Five multiple-choice tests were employed and scored using the Coombs procedure. Results suggest that the Coombs procedure decreased guessing, and this effect increased over the grading period.
